Africa is often presented as a paradox. Apart from being endowed with a rich mosaic of natural resources, it is also the youngest continent, demographically, making for considerable opportunity for sustainable development. Yet, Africa is bedeviled with serious challenges, including the ongoing migrant crisis in the Mediterranean Ocean, climate change and natural resource depletion, slow gender mainstreaming, endemic corruption, security challenges, the ravages of pandemics like Ebola, to name a few. Thus, on all counts, in both intra- and inter- national arenas, Africa is at a crossroad in the 21st century, faced with numerous opportunities and challenges that demand serious and careful consideration.
This conference is open to Masters, PhD students and Post-Doctoral fellows. We invite paper submissions that will critically reflect on Africa’s development trajectory. Papers from scholars in the social sciences, humanities, and African studies that engage in an inter-disciplinary dialogue around any of the following core themes are particularly welcome:
